Sleep Center Manager jobs in Cleveland, OH

Sleep Center Manager manages and oversees the day-to-day operations of one or more sleep centers. Responsibilities may include staffing, training, scheduling, budgeting, and marketing for the center(s). Being a Sleep Center Manager ensures patient care meets high-quality standards. Develops and implements policies and procedures for the sleep center(s). Additionally, Sleep Center Manager typically requires a bachelor's degree. Requires registration as a Polysomnographic Technician. Typically reports to a director. The Sleep Center Manager manages subordinate staff in the day-to-day performance of their jobs. True first level manager. Ensures that project/department milestones/goals are met and adhering to approved budgets. Has full authority for personnel actions. To be a Sleep Center Manager typically requires 5 years experience in the related area as an individual contributor. 1-3 years supervisory experience may be required. Extensive knowledge of the function and department processes.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

    Our Sleep Contact Center Specialist  Responsible for incoming phone inquiries related to PAP therapy, scheduling appointments with respiratory therapists, and working to ensure excellent customer service.   
     
    Responsibilities and Duties:
     
    • Proficiency in company Enterprise System necessary to enter orders, research patient inquires and status updates for new equipment.
    • Handles inbound patient calls, utilizing listening skills to ensure patient’s needs and concerns regarding their equipment or services are addressed. Ensures that all requests are handled accurately and efficiently.
    • Communicate with patients and referrals regarding order status, delivery schedules, and any necessary documentation or information required.
    • Address patient inquiries, concerns, and provide appropriate support throughout the ordering process.
    • Verify insurance coverage and previous DME history as required.
    • Efficiently schedule appointments for patients, considering availability, urgency, and specific requirements.
    • Utilize the scheduling system to manage appointment calendars and optimize the booking process.
    • Streamline the appointment booking process to minimize wait times and maximize efficiency.
    • Schedule patients needing appointments with Respiratory Therapists (RT) for PAP set ups, mask refits, RT education, etc.
    • Quality insurance, disclose patient financial responsibility and collect method of payment as required by MSC protocol.
    • Communicate compliance requirements in first 90 days of PAP therapy to patient to ensure continued insurance coverage.
    • Identifies complimentary products that may benefit the patient while providing additional information about the equipment.
    • Contact appropriate parties to obtain any missing information as necessary.
    • Input patient information and orders into system as necessary.
    • Responsible for meeting metric standards set by Sleep Contact Center Manager to ensure success.
    • Excellent communication skills to interact with customers over the phone and provide support.
    • Displays patience, empathy, active listening and understanding to address customer concerns and inquiries.
    • Strong problem-solving skills to identify and resolve customer issues effectively.
    • Proficient in explaining complex technical information in a clear and understandable manner
    • Ability to accurately document patient and referral interactions, including issue descriptions, resolutions, and follow-up actions taken.
    • Knowledge of privacy and data protection regulations, such as the Health Insurance Portability and Accountability Act (HIPAA).
    • Ability to work effectively as part of a team, collaborating with other call center specialists, technicians, and healthcare professionals.
    • Willingness to share knowledge and support colleagues when needed.
    • Strong organizational skills to handle multiple customer inquiries and tasks simultaneously.
    • Ability to prioritize and manage time effectively to meet service level agreements and response time targets.
    • Perform other duties as assigned.

Cleveland (/ˈkliːvlənd/ KLEEV-lənd) is a major city in the U.S. state of Ohio, and the county seat of Cuyahoga County. The city proper has a population of 385,525, making it the 51st-largest city in the United States, and the second-largest city in Ohio. Greater Cleveland is ranked as the 32nd-largest metropolitan area in the U.S., with 2,055,612 people in 2016. The city anchors the Cleveland–Akron–Canton Combined Statistical Area, which had a population of 3,515,646 in 2010 and is ranked 15th in the United States.
